#1e5974 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1e5974 is composed of 11.8% red, 34.9% green and 45.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.1% cyan, 23.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 54.5% black. It has a hue angle of 198.8 degrees, a saturation of 58.9% and a lightness of 28.6%. #1e5974 color hex could be obtained by blending #3cb2e8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

#1e5974 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1e5974 has RGB values of R:30, G:89, B:116 and CMYK values of C:0.74, M:0.23, Y:0, K:0.55. Its decimal value is 1988980.
